Understanding the Asset Specifications
The core value of any digital clip art lies in its technical quality. The 9 Taiyaki 3D PNG package consists of nine distinct image files. Each file is provided at a resolution of 3000×3000 pixels. This square aspect ratio is versatile, allowing for easy cropping or scaling without losing critical details. More importantly, the images are rendered at 300 DPI (dots per inch). In the printing industry, 300 DPI is the standard benchmark for ensuring sharp, vibrant outputs. Whether the end product is a physical merchandise item or a high-resolution digital display, this density ensures that edges remain crisp and colors stay true, avoiding the pixelation often associated with lower-quality web graphics.

Licensing and Commercial Usage Rights
A critical factor in selecting digital assets is the scope of the license. This collection is marketed for commercial use, but with specific boundaries that users must respect. The license permits the integration of these clip art files into broader designs and products. This includes advertisements, marketing materials, merchandise, print-on-demand (POD) items, packaging, planners, scrapbooks, decorations, and various digital products.
However, there is a significant restriction: no standalone sales. Users may not sell the PNG files as they are. The assets must be incorporated into a new, transformative design. For example, placing a taiyaki image on a t-shirt, using it as part of a logo for a bakery, or including it in a digital planner template is permitted. Reselling the raw files on a stock photo site or distributing them independently is prohibited. Understanding this distinction is vital for maintaining compliance and avoiding legal issues.

Comparing Alternatives
When deciding whether to purchase this specific pack, designers should compare it against alternatives. Vector-based SVG files offer infinite scalability and smaller file sizes, which can be advantageous for web development and large-format printing. However, vectors often lack the textured, hand-drawn depth that raster-based PNGs provide. If the project requires a soft, painted, or 3D-rendered look, PNGs are often the superior choice.
Free stock photo sites offer cost-effective alternatives, but they frequently lack the cohesive style and specific niche focus of curated packs like this one. Free assets may also come with ambiguous licensing terms or lower resolutions. Investing in a dedicated pack ensures consistency in style and clarity in usage rights, which can save time and reduce risk in commercial projects.
